public HomeController(ILogger <HomeController> logger, TimedService backGroundService, StartAutBackgroundService bk) { _logger = logger; _backgroundService = backGroundService; _logger.LogInformation("{data}<=>{Messege}", DateTime.Now.ToString("dd.MM.yyyy hh:mm:ss"), "S-A CREAT HOMECONTROLLER AR TREBUI SA URMEZE SI BACKGROUND SERVICE"); _logger.LogInformation("{LasttimeScan} {text}", _backgroundService.LastTimeRunBackgroundWork.ToString("dd.MM.yyyy hh:mm:ss"), "Timp din backgroundService in HomeController"); }
public TasksController(BackServiceUtil util, BlogContext db, TimedService timedService, Microsoft.Extensions.Configuration.IConfiguration configuration) { _util = util; _db = db; _configuration = configuration; _timedService = timedService; }
public static TimedService <T> RegisterTimedService <T>(this ServiceController <T> controller, float duration, T meta, bool ignoreTimeScale = false, ushort priority = Service.DefaultPriority) { var service = new TimedService <T>(duration, meta, ignoreTimeScale, priority); controller.RegisterService(service); return(service); }